🥕 SNAP Food Stamps in Niagara County
SNAP (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program) helps eligible Niagara County residents pay for groceries each month using an EBT card. Niagara County has two DSS office locations — in Niagara Falls and Lockport.
Apply through mybenefits.ny.gov — easiest option for Niagara County residents.
Visit either office — Niagara Falls at 301 10th Street or Lockport at 20 East Avenue. Walk-in hours end at 3:45pm.
Use the free NYDocSubmit app or fax to (716) 278-6837. Text “food” to 877-877 for nearby food pantry info.
If approved, benefits are loaded onto your EBT card for eligible grocery purchases at most stores.

SNAP Income Guidelines 2026
| Household Size | Monthly Income Limit |
|---|---|
| 1 person | $1,580 |
| 2 people | $2,137 |
| 3 people | $2,694 |
| 4 people | $3,250 |
| 5 people | $3,807 |
| Each additional | + $557 |
🏥 Medicaid in Niagara County
Medicaid provides free or low-cost health coverage for eligible Niagara County residents. For nursing home and chronic care Medicaid, contact the Lockport office directly. Home care services are also available through the DSS.
Apply through NY State of Health at nystateofhealth.ny.gov or call (855) 355-5777.
Call (716) 278-8400 for Medicaid applications at the Niagara Falls office.
Call the Nursing Homes & Chronic Care line at (716) 439-7728 for long-term care applications.
If approved, enroll in a Medicaid Managed Care plan for your covered services.
- Doctor visits and checkups
- Hospital care
- Prescription medications
- Mental health services
- Nursing home and chronic care
- Medical transportation to appointments
🏠 Housing Assistance
Niagara County residents may qualify for emergency rental assistance, temporary shelter, and housing support programs through the county DSS.
Rental assistance available for eligible households — call (716) 278-8400 for information.
Help available for eviction, utility shut-off, homelessness, no food, or domestic violence situations.
Call 2-1-1 for after-hours emergency housing and shelter assistance in Niagara County.
